在日常办公和数据分析工作中,Excel求平均数功能被广泛应用于各类数据处理场景。无论是企业财务、销售统计、学业成绩还是生产管理,掌握Excel的平均数计算方法,能够帮助我们更准确地分析数据走势,把握业务脉络。那么,Excel求平均数的原理是什么?实际应用场景有哪些?让我们逐步深入理解。
一、Excel求平均数怎么用?基础原理与实际场景解析
1、平均数的定义及意义
平均数,又称为算术平均值,是将一组数据的总和除以该组数据的数量所得出的值。在数据分析中,平均数常用于衡量总体水平,反映数据的集中趋势。
- 公式示例: 平均数 = 总和 / 数据个数 比如有一组数据:20、30、40、50、60,平均数为 (20+30+40+50+60)/5 = 40
- 应用场景:
- 企业员工工资水平分析
- 学生成绩评定
- 产品销售均价
- 客户满意度调查
- 优势:
- 操作简单,易于理解
- 能直观反映数据整体状况
- 适用于大部分数据分布
2、Excel中平均数的常用函数介绍
在Excel中,求平均数最常用的函数是AVERAGE,除此之外,还有一些扩展函数可以应对更复杂的需求:
- AVERAGE: 求选定单元格区域的算术平均值
- AVERAGEIF: 求满足特定条件的数据的平均值
- AVERAGEIFS: 可对多条件筛选后求平均
- SUBTOTAL: 可结合筛选功能,动态计算平均值
| 函数名称 | 功能描述 | 典型应用场景 |
|---|---|---|
| AVERAGE | 求一组数据的平均值 | 日常数据统计 |
| AVERAGEIF | 满足单条件的数据求平均 | 业绩达标员工平均工资 |
| AVERAGEIFS | 多条件筛选数据求平均 | 多地区、多产品均价分析 |
| SUBTOTAL | 支持筛选后动态平均 | 数据透视分析 |
3、为什么选择Excel进行平均数计算?
Excel求平均数怎么用?详细步骤与常见问题解析的核心原因,在于Excel不仅操作便捷,而且其函数体系灵活,能够满足多层次、多角度的数据分析需求。
- 批量处理能力强:一次性计算成百上千条数据,远超手工计算效率
- 可视化结果展示:计算结果可直接用于图表、报表呈现
- 数据清洗与筛选方便:结合筛选、排序、条件格式,平均数结果更精准
- 与其他统计分析无缝集成:支持数据透视表、汇总、分组等多种分析方式
例如,企业每月员工绩效评分汇总,管理者可通过Excel快速得出全员平均分,识别团队整体表现,及时调整激励政策。
4、实际案例分析:销售数据平均值计算
假设某公司销售部,统计Q1季度各月产品销售额如下:
| 月份 | 产品A销售额 | 产品B销售额 | 产品C销售额 |
|---|---|---|---|
| 1月 | 12000 | 15000 | 10000 |
| 2月 | 13000 | 14000 | 11000 |
| 3月 | 12500 | 15500 | 9500 |
如何用Excel计算各产品Q1平均销售额?
- 选中产品A销售额区域(B2:B4)
- 在空白单元格输入
=AVERAGE(B2:B4) - 回车,即得产品A的平均销售额
- 同理对其他产品操作即可
计算结果如下:
| 产品 | Q1平均销售额 |
|---|---|
| A | 12500 |
| B | 14833.33 |
| C | 10166.67 |
5、扩展思考:Excel之外的解决方案
虽然Excel在平均数计算方面表现优异,但面对复杂、动态的数据填报和统计需求时,传统Excel往往受限于协同能力和流程管理。此时,选择简道云这样的零代码数字化平台,不仅能实现在线数据填报,还能高效自动化流程审批与统计分析。简道云是IDC认证国内市场占有率第一的零代码数字化平台,拥有2000w+用户和200w+团队的信赖。它可以替代Excel进行更灵活的数据处理,助力企业实现数据资产的智能化管理。 试用链接: 简道云设备管理系统模板在线试用:www.jiandaoyun.com
二、Excel求平均数详细步骤解析
掌握Excel求平均数的具体操作,是每位数据处理人员的基础技能。下面我们将以详细步骤,配合实际场景和技巧,帮助大家真正理解Excel求平均数怎么用?详细步骤与常见问题解析的核心内容。
1、基本操作步骤详解
以常规方法求平均数:
- 准备数据
- 将需要求平均的数据输入到Excel表格中,确保数据连续且无误。
- 例如,在A1:A10单元格输入10组销售数据。
- 选择目标区域
- 用鼠标选中包含数据的单元格区域(如A1:A10)。
- 输入AVERAGE公式
- 在目标单元格输入
=AVERAGE(A1:A10),按回车即可得出平均值。
- 公式拖拉扩展
- 若有多列需要求平均,可将公式向右或向下拖拉快速复制。
操作要点总结:
- 数据格式必须为数字型,否则公式无法计算
- 空白单元格会被自动忽略,不影响结果
- 文本型数据需提前清洗为数字型
2、条件求平均数:AVERAGEIF与AVERAGEIFS
实际业务中,常需要对部分数据进行条件筛选后再求平均。例如,只统计部门为“销售”的员工工资平均值。
AVERAGEIF 用法:
- 语法:
=AVERAGEIF(条件范围, 条件, 求平均范围) - 示例:统计“销售”部门员工的平均工资 假设部门在A2:A10,工资在B2:B10 公式:
=AVERAGEIF(A2:A10, "销售", B2:B10)
AVERAGEIFS 用法:
- 语法:
=AVERAGEIFS(求平均范围, 条件范围1, 条件1, 条件范围2, 条件2, ...) - 示例:统计“销售”部门且年龄大于30岁的员工平均工资 部门在A2:A10,年龄在C2:C10,工资在B2:B10 公式:
=AVERAGEIFS(B2:B10, A2:A10, "销售", C2:C10, ">30")
实用技巧:
- 支持模糊匹配,如 "销售*" 可匹配“销售一部”、“销售二部”
- 多条件筛选时,确保条件范围与数据范围长度一致
3、动态求平均数:结合筛选与SUBTOTAL
在数据量大且需经常筛选时,直接用AVERAGE无法实时反映当前筛选结果。此时,SUBTOTAL函数可以解决这个问题。
SUBTOTAL的用法:
- 语法:
=SUBTOTAL(函数编号, 求平均范围) - 平均数函数编号为101或1(Excel 2010及以上建议用101)
- 示例:
=SUBTOTAL(101, B2:B100)
操作流程:
- 对数据表使用筛选功能(如只显示某一部门数据)
- 在统计区域输入SUBTOTAL公式,结果会自动根据筛选内容变化
优点:
- 适合数据透视表、分组统计等动态场景
- 快速反映当前视图下的平均值
4、数据清洗与错误处理
求平均数常见数据问题及处理方法:
- 数据中含非数字字符:需提前用“文本转列”或“查找替换”功能清除
- 空单元格和零值:AVERAGE会自动忽略空单元格,但零值会计入结果
- 数据异常值:若数据中有极端异常值,可结合条件格式突出显示并人工核查
- 重复值与去重:有时需先去重再求平均,可用“删除重复项”功能
5、可视化结果展示与报告输出
Excel平均数计算结果可以直接用于生成图表、报表,提升数据解读效率:
- 柱状图、折线图直观展现平均水平变化趋势
- 数据透视表结合平均数计算,适合多维度业务分析
- 条件格式设置高于或低于平均值的颜色标识,一眼识别异常
案例: 假设某班级学生成绩统计,求平均分并用柱状图展示结果
| 学生姓名 | 成绩 |
|---|---|
| 张三 | 85 |
| 李四 | 90 |
| 王五 | 78 |
| 赵六 | 92 |
| 钱七 | 88 |
平均分公式:=AVERAGE(B2:B6),结果为86.6 插入柱状图后,平均分可作为参考线,直观对比各学生成绩水平。
6、高级技巧:数组公式与自定义计算
对于特定业务场景(如复合条件、自动排除异常值),可用数组公式或自定义函数实现平均数计算。例如,排除最低和最高分后求平均:
- 公式示例:
=(SUM(B2:B6)-MAX(B2:B6)-MIN(B2:B6))/(COUNT(B2:B6)-2)
这种方法可避免极端值影响整体平均水平,常用于绩效考核、竞赛评分等场景。
三、Excel求平均数常见问题解析与实用解决方案
在实际使用Excel进行平均数计算时,用户常遇到各种疑难杂症。下面针对Excel求平均数怎么用?详细步骤与常见问题解析中的高频问题,进行深入分析与实用解答,帮助大家少走弯路。
1、公式结果显示错误或为0
核心原因:
- 选区中包含非数字型数据或文本
- 数据格式不一致,部分单元格为“文本型”
- 数据区域有空白或错误值
解决方法:
- 检查数据格式,批量设置为“数字”
- 用“文本转列”功能批量转换
- 对公式区域用“错误检查”功能定位问题
2、分组或筛选后平均数不变
用AVERAGE公式时,筛选数据后平均数不随筛选结果变化,原因是AVERAGE统计所有原始数据。 建议用SUBTOTAL函数,它能根据筛选结果动态调整统计范围。
3、如何排除空值与异常值
空值处理:
- AVERAGE自动忽略空单元格
- 若需自定义排除规则,建议用数组公式或辅助列筛选
异常值处理:
- 可用条件格式突出显示异常
- 用公式排除极端值 如:
=(SUM(B2:B100)-MAX(B2:B100)-MIN(B2:B100))/(COUNT(B2:B100)-2)
4、跨表/跨工作簿求平均数
有时需要统计多个表格或工作簿的数据平均值,操作方式如下:
- 跨表公式:
=AVERAGE(表1!A1:A10, 表2!A1:A10) - 跨工作簿公式:
=AVERAGE([文件1.xlsx]Sheet1!A1:A10, [文件2.xlsx]Sheet1!A1:A10)
注意:
- 保证所有工作簿均打开或路径正确
- 数据格式统一
5、自动化与批量处理技巧
面对多表、多列、多区域数据时,Excel的填充柄和公式拖拉功能极为高效,结合数据透视表、宏命令,可实现自动化平均数统计:
- 用数据透视表“值字段设置”选择“平均值”快速统计
- 用宏批量处理多个表格,提升效率
- 用条件格式自动标记高于/低于平均数的数据
6、Excel之外的高效解法:简道云推荐
当数据填报、流程审批、统计分析需求越来越复杂时,传统Excel可能面临协同难、流程管控弱等问题。此时,推荐尝试简道云这一零代码数字化平台,能在线完成数据收集、统计、审批等全流程自动化,极大提升效率。 简道云是IDC认证国内市场占有率第一的零代码平台,拥有2000w+用户、200w+团队。它支持Excel表格导入,一键生成在线表单和统计报表,数据随时同步、权限灵活管控。 试用链接: 简道云设备管理系统模板在线试用:www.jiandaoyun.com
7、实用问答速查表
| 问题 | 推荐解决方法 |
|---|---|
| 求平均数公式不显示结果 | 检查数据格式,排查文本型数据 |
| 数据筛选后平均数不更新 | 使用SUBTOTAL函数 |
| 如何排除异常值 | 用自定义公式去除极端值 |
| 多条件筛选后求平均数 | 用AVERAGEIFS函数 |
| 跨表统计平均数 | 用跨表公式或数据透视表 |
| 数据收集、审批效率低 | 推荐使用简道云在线平台 |
8、用户易犯错误总结
- 忽略数据格式统一,导致公式无效
- 公式区域选错,计算结果异常
- 不使用条件函数,无法精准统计
- 忘记排除异常值,结果失真
建议:
- 养成数据清洗习惯
- 多用条件与动态函数
- 结合可视化工具辅助分析
- 遇到复杂需求时,及时尝试简道云等新型数字化工具
四、全文总结与简道云推荐
本文围绕“Excel求平均数怎么用?详细步骤与常见问题解析”这一主题,深入剖析了平均数的基本原理、Excel常用函数、详细操作步骤及实际场景,并针对高频问题给出了实用解决方案。我们不仅学习了如何在Excel中高效求平均数,还掌握了数据清洗、动态统计、条件筛选等进阶技巧。对于需要更高效数据收集、流程审批和统计分析的用户,简道云作为国内市场占有率第一的零代码数字化平台,是Excel之外的强大选择。它支持在线数据填报、自动统计和灵活流程管控,助力企业和团队数字化转型。 欢迎体验: 简道云设备管理系统模板在线试用:www.jiandaoyun.com 无论你是Excel新手还是数据分析高手,希望本文能为你的工作带来实用提升,让数据分析变得更轻松高效! 🚀
本文相关FAQs
1. Excel求平均数时,如何处理空值和非数值数据?会影响计算结果吗?
有时候在用Excel求平均数时,发现表格里既有数字,也有空单元格甚至一些文字,搞不清楚Excel到底会不会把这些非数值内容算进去。很多人担心这样会影响最终的平均值计算结果,尤其是数据量大的时候,一点小误差可能就会导致整体分析不准确。所以这个问题真的挺实用,毕竟谁还没遇到过数据不规范的情况呢。
大家好,这个问题我自己踩过不少坑,分享下我的经验。
- Excel自带的AVERAGE函数其实很智能,遇到空单元格或者纯文本(比如字母或者汉字)的时候,它会自动忽略这些内容,只计算实际的数字。
- 举个例子,如果你选了A1:A10,其中A3是空的,A5是“无数据”,剩下都是数字,Excel只会统计数字那几项来算平均值。
- 但是要注意一点,如果单元格里有类似“3abc”这种混合内容,Excel会把它当作文本,直接跳过。这也意味着你表格里的怪数据不会拖累平均数。
- 还有一种特殊情况,如果单元格里是0,Excel会算进去。空白和文本不算,0是数字,所以会影响平均值。
如果你经常遇到数据不规范,可以先用筛选功能把非数值内容过滤掉,或者用ISNUMBER函数配合筛选,让求平均数更精准。 其实用数据管理工具也很方便,比如我最近发现 简道云在线试用:www.jiandaoyun.com 可以一键清洗和统计数据,省了不少手工操作。
你们有没有碰到过求平均数失误的情况?可以留言聊聊。
2. Excel里怎么用条件筛选后再求平均数?比如只算“及格以上”的分数
有时候老师或者HR会说:“我们只需要统计60分以上的平均分”,但Excel默认是全选一列直接算。想要只算符合条件的数据(比如及格线以上),到底该怎么操作?是不是得用什么特殊公式?这个问题其实很常见,尤其是做成绩统计或者员工绩效的时候,经常遇到。
嘿,关于这个条件筛选平均数,我之前做学生成绩分析时用得超多。
- 常规的AVERAGE函数是没法加条件的,所以要用AVERAGEIF或者AVERAGEIFS。
- 举个例子,如果你的分数在B2:B100,想只计算60分以上的平均数,可以用这个公式:
=AVERAGEIF(B2:B100,">=60") - 公式的意思就是,只统计B2到B100里大于等于60的数值,然后求平均。
- 如果你还有“科目”这一列,想进一步筛选,比如只算“数学”及格分,可以用AVERAGEIFS,支持多条件。
这个方法不光能筛分数,工资、业绩什么都能用。用的时候记得检查下数据里有没有空值或文本,避免结果不准确。 大家有没遇到过复杂筛选场景?可以交流下更多用法。
3. 平均数计算出来后,怎么让Excel自动显示小数位数?有什么实用技巧吗?
算完平均数后,发现结果只有整数或者小数点后乱七八糟,特别希望能统一显示成两位小数,提升表格美观和专业度。有没有什么快捷设置,或者批量调整的办法?很多人可能还不知道Excel有细致的数值格式功能,这个问题值得聊聊。
嗨,关于平均数小数位的显示,我自己做报表时也很注重这个细节。
- 最简单的方法是,选中你要求平均数的那个单元格,然后点“开始”菜单里的“增加小数位”或者“减少小数位”按钮,直接就能调节显示两位或一位小数。
- 还可以右键单元格,选择“设置单元格格式”,在“数字”分类里选“数值”,自定义小数位数,比如设置成2,就是“0.00”这种效果。
- 如果你有一列平均数要批量调整,也可以选中多行一起操作,Excel会一次性改好。
这不仅让表格看起来更专业,输出给老板或者客户也更有说服力。如果有特殊需求,比如要显示百分比,也可以在格式设置里选“百分比”类型。
你们平时喜欢用几位小数?还是直接用整数?欢迎讨论下你的习惯。
4. Excel里怎么避免平均数被异常值(极端数据)扭曲?有没有什么好办法?
在实际工作中,总会遇到几个特别大的或者特别小的数据,导致平均数被拉偏,结果和实际情况不符。比如员工年终奖金,有人特别高,平均一算就离谱。有什么方法能让Excel自动过滤这些异常值,算出更靠谱的平均数吗?
大家好,这个异常值问题我之前做市场分析时遇到过,确实挺麻烦。
- 第一种办法是人工筛选,比如用排序功能把最大、最小的数据先找出来,然后剔除后再用AVERAGE函数算一遍。
- 还有一种更智能的方法,就是用“分位数”或“中位数”来辅助分析。Excel的MEDIAN函数能算出中位数,这样就不怕极端值影响结果。
- 如果想自动过滤,比如只算处于某个范围的数据,可以用AVERAGEIFS,加一组条件,比如只算大于10且小于1000的数据:
=AVERAGEIFS(B2:B100,B2:B100,">10",B2:B100,"<1000") - 还有一些复杂场景,可以用公式结合IF、ABS函数自定义规则,把偏离平均值太远的数据剔除。
如果数据量很大,建议先用图表看看数据分布,或者用专业的数据清洗工具处理。 你们有没有什么更实用的异常值处理经验?欢迎补充!
5. 有没有办法用Excel自动统计每个分类的平均数?比如按部门、产品分组
在做分析时,经常遇到需要按某个分类(比如部门、产品、地区)分别统计平均数。如果手动筛选太慢了,尤其是分类多的时候,Excel有没有什么自动化的好方法能批量统计每组的平均数?这个需求在做绩效、销售分析时特别常见。
你好,这个分类统计平均数我刚好最近也在用。
- 推荐用Excel的“数据透视表”功能,真的特别强大。
- 操作方法是:选中你的数据区域,点“插入”-“数据透视表”,然后把分类字段拖到“行”,数值字段拖到“值”,默认就是求和,点开可以改成“平均值”。
- 这样每个部门、产品、地区都会自动生成一行平均数,省了手工筛选的麻烦。
- 如果你数据结构比较简单,也可以用SUMIF和COUNTIF组合成平均数,但数据透视表更灵活。
数据透视表还能随时切换字段、做交叉分析,非常适合做多维度统计。如果你还没用过,强烈建议试试。 大家有什么更高级的分组统计方法,也欢迎留言分享!

